The thriving Senior School has 450 pupils ranging in age from 13 to 18 years, who are supported by 80 qualified and committed teaching staff, coaches and pastoral care specialists. Sedbergh Junior School, including a Pre-Prep department, has now moved to the same location and is going from strength to strength with 100 girls and boys aged 4 to 13.”
